HYLO Champions League scores China media breakthrough

The European Table Tennis Union (ETTU), together with its longstanding Munich-based agency antesi media gmbh (antesi), is proud to announce a major breakthrough in the Chinese media market for the HYLO ETTU Champions League Men. Leveraging the growing popularity of European club table tennis in China, ETTU and antesi have worked with Aurora Sports Group (ASG) as the exclusive strategic partner in China to secured agreements with six leading Chinese media outlets, significantly expanding the visibility of ETTU competitions in the world’s largest table tennis market.

Since the start of the 2025/26 season, Chinese Olympic champion FAN Zhendong has been competing for German club 1. FC Saarbrücken TT in the HYLO ETTU Champions League. His participation in Europe’s premier club competition has triggered an unprecedented wave of interest among Chinese fans and media in European table tennis and, in particular, in HYLO ETTU Champions League matches.

Building on this momentum, ASG has strategically orchestrated media rights partnerships with a strong line-up of Chinese platforms. Bilibili, Douyin, iQiyi, Migu and Youku sports will stream HYLO ETTU Champions League matches on their respective digital platforms, making the competition widely accessible to Chinese fans across multiple devices and viewing habits.

In addition, CCTV 5, China’s leading sports free-to-air channel, will serve as the exclusive free-to-air partner in China for the HYLO ETTU Champions League Final 4. This marks a significant milestone in positioning the HYLO ETTU Champions League alongside the most prestigious international sports properties featured on Chinese television.

ETTU President Pedro MOURA commented:

“This partnership opens a new chapter for the HYLO ETTU Champions League. By strengthening our presence in China, we are bringing European table tennis to one of the most passionate audiences in the world and reinforcing our global ambitions.”

The collaboration between ETTU, antesi and Aurora Sports Group is designed as a long-term strategic partnership aimed at establishing European table tennis under the ETTU umbrella as a fully developed and recognisable premium product in China. All parties will continue to work closely together to enhance the production, distribution and storytelling around the HYLO ETTU Champions League and other ETTU properties for Chinese audiences, stakeholders and commercial partners.

The European Table Tennis Union (ETTU) is the governing body of the sport of table tennis in Europe, and is the only authority recognized for this purpose by the International Table Tennis Federation. The ETTU deals with all matters relating to table tennis at a European level, including the development and promotion of the sport in the territories controlled by its 58 member associations, and the organization of continental table tennis competitions, including the European Championships.
